The Midland Park Chamber has been
busy at work for 2014. We are pleased to
announce the launch of our website and
new logo for mid February. Our website
will serve to provide local residents infor-
mation about the town and chamber events,
a business directory and promotions/spe-
cial offers for “friends of the Midland Park
Chamber”. Each MPC business is being asked to
offer local residents a special offer or busi-
ness incentive for visiting the website and
shopping locally. We hope to use the web-
site to connect residents to the chamber
businesses and serve as a tool for provid-
ing information regarding special events
and scheduling of Midland Park Chamber
events, to name a few features.
The Midland Park Chamber of Com-
merce in collaboration with the Midland
Park Jr/Sr High School will be hosting a
Career Day and Business Expo on Monday,
March 10 at the high school. We are cur-
rently looking for businesses interested in
presenting during the Career Day portion
of the event from 8:15 a.m. to 1 p.m. and
businesses interested in setting up a table
at the Business Expo from 5 to 7 p.m. to
be held in the gym and open to the com-
munity. Students will have an opportunity
to discuss career options and job prospects
with local merchants, service individuals,
eateries and more. Local residents will
have hands on meet-and-greet opportuni-
ties with each local business. This is a great
opportunity for the local businesses and
residents to get involved in fostering good
relations. If you are interested in getting
involved, please contact event coordinator
Lisa Plasse at flute76@aol.com to receive a
registration form. The deadline to register
is Feb. 6. There is no charge for current
Chamber businesses.
